Data Structures in Java for Noobs (Lite Edition)

Why take this course?
🎓 Data Structures in Java for Noobs (Lite Edition): A Comprehensive, Step-by-Step Guide
🚀 Course Headline: Unlock the Mysteries of Data Structures with Ease - Data Structures Made Simple With Step by Step Instructions and Diagrams
**📘 Course Description:
Embark on a journey to master the fundamentals of data structures using Java, tailored specifically for beginners! In this course, "Data Structures in Java for Noobs (Lite Edition), you'll dive into two essential data structures that form the bedrock of software development:
- 🔗 Singly Linked Lists: Learn how to create and manipulate nodes, traverse lists, and understand the implications of O(1) vs. O(n) operations.
- ↔️ Doubly Linked Lists: Explore the additional capabilities that come with bidirectional pointers, and see how they can simplify certain data management tasks.
Why Data Structures? 🤔
Before we leap into coding, let's address a common question: Why learn data structures in the first place? Here are two compelling reasons:
-
Interview Preparedness: Data structures are a staple in technical interviews across various programming domains. Command of these concepts can set you apart from your peers and demonstrate your problem-solving abilities.
-
Informed Decision-Making: Understanding the intricacies behind data structures empowers you to make more informed decisions when choosing the right data structure for a particular use case. This leads to more efficient, scalable, and maintainable code.
🔍 What You'll Learn:
- Fundamentals: Get to grips with the core concepts of data structures without being overwhelmed by advanced topics.
- Hands-On Practice: Engage with practical examples that illustrate how each structure operates, and apply your knowledge through exercises.
- Real-World Application: Learn the contexts in which each data structure is most effective, so you can confidently apply them in real-world scenarios.
- Visual Learning: Benefit from clear diagrams that visually represent complex ideas, making them easy to understand and remember.
- Best Practices: Gain insights into industry best practices for implementing and utilizing these data structures within your Java applications.
🎓 Course Highlights:
- Step-by-Step Instructions: No prior knowledge of data structures is required; we start from the very basics and build up your understanding incrementally.
- Diagrammatic Explanations: Complex concepts are simplified with easy-to-follow diagrams that help you grasp the mechanics behind each data structure.
- Real-World Examples: Apply your knowledge by working through examples that mirror real-life programming challenges.
- Expert Instructor: Learn from Pedro Mercado, an instructor with a knack for breaking down complex topics into digestible lessons.
👩💻 Who Is This Course For?
- Beginners who are new to data structures and looking for a clear, concise introduction.
- Aspiring developers aiming to build a strong foundation in Java and its data structures.
- Individuals preparing for technical interviews and wanting to strengthen their problem-solving skills with data structures.
Join us on this educational adventure as we demystify the world of data structures together! 🚀💻✨
Course Gallery




Loading charts...